z-opac.h File Reference

ASN.1 Module RecordSyntax-opac. More...

#include <yaz/odr.h>
#include <yaz/z-core.h>

Go to the source code of this file.

Data Structures

struct  Z_OPACRecord
struct  Z_HoldingsRecord
struct  Z_HoldingsAndCircData
struct  Z_Volume
struct  Z_CircRecord

Defines

#define Z_HoldingsRecord_marcHoldingsRecord   1
#define Z_HoldingsRecord_holdingsAndCirc   2

Typedefs

typedef struct Z_OPACRecord Z_OPACRecord
typedef struct Z_HoldingsRecord Z_HoldingsRecord
typedef struct
Z_HoldingsAndCircData 
Z_HoldingsAndCircData
typedef struct Z_Volume Z_Volume
typedef struct Z_CircRecord Z_CircRecord

Functions

int z_OPACRecord (ODR o, Z_OPACRecord **p, int opt, const char *name)
int z_HoldingsRecord (ODR o, Z_HoldingsRecord **p, int opt, const char *name)
int z_HoldingsAndCircData (ODR o, Z_HoldingsAndCircData **p, int opt, const char *name)
int z_Volume (ODR o, Z_Volume **p, int opt, const char *name)
int z_CircRecord (ODR o, Z_CircRecord **p, int opt, const char *name)


Detailed Description

ASN.1 Module RecordSyntax-opac.

Generated automatically by YAZ ASN.1 Compiler 0.4

Definition in file z-opac.h.


Define Documentation

#define Z_HoldingsRecord_holdingsAndCirc   2

Definition at line 48 of file z-opac.h.

Referenced by dummy_opac(), yaz_opac_decode_wrbuf(), and z_HoldingsRecord().

#define Z_HoldingsRecord_marcHoldingsRecord   1

Definition at line 47 of file z-opac.h.

Referenced by yaz_opac_decode_wrbuf(), and z_HoldingsRecord().


Typedef Documentation

typedef struct Z_CircRecord Z_CircRecord

Definition at line 28 of file z-opac.h.

Definition at line 22 of file z-opac.h.

Definition at line 19 of file z-opac.h.

typedef struct Z_OPACRecord Z_OPACRecord

Definition at line 16 of file z-opac.h.

typedef struct Z_Volume Z_Volume

Definition at line 25 of file z-opac.h.


Function Documentation

int z_CircRecord ( ODR  o,
Z_CircRecord **  p,
int  opt,
const char *  name 
)

int z_HoldingsAndCircData ( ODR  o,
Z_HoldingsAndCircData **  p,
int  opt,
const char *  name 
)

int z_HoldingsRecord ( ODR  o,
Z_HoldingsRecord **  p,
int  opt,
const char *  name 
)

int z_OPACRecord ( ODR  o,
Z_OPACRecord **  p,
int  opt,
const char *  name 
)

int z_Volume ( ODR  o,
Z_Volume **  p,
int  opt,
const char *  name 
)


Generated on Wed Jun 18 11:17:04 2008 for YAZ by  doxygen 1.5.6